Saint-Benoît in Réunion is a coastal administrative area on the island’s northeast, with access to warm Indian Ocean water and local reef-rich habitats nearby. The region’s diving relevance is limited to nearby marine environments along the coast, with centers typically serving broader eastern Réunion routes. Expect temperate-to-warm water, moderate visibility, and common reef-associated life in nearby shallows and drop-offs when present, though detailed dive sites are not concentrated within the Canton itself.

The best times to dive in the Canton de Saint-Benoît-2 region
The best months to dive in Canton de Saint-Benoît-2 are from January to March. Temperatures are confortable (26-27°C), currents are mild and the visibility is at its best.
Based on last year's weather. Scores compare months for this destination only and are indicative. A mitigated month may still suit many divers.
